                                  @rmeskill said in High interrupts on WAN/LAN interfaces?:

                                  dev.igc.0.mac_stats.good_pkts_recvd: 147664355
                                  dev.igc.0.mac_stats.total_pkts_recvd: 147669598

                                  Hmm, the only thing I see there is that. Implying ~5000 bad packets received. But no errors so probably just rejected. Not really a huge number out of 147M.

                                  I see about the same percentages here:

                                  dev.igc.3.mac_stats.good_pkts_recvd: 1208385
                                  dev.igc.3.mac_stats.total_pkts_recvd: 1208642
                                  

                                  And have no issues.

                                  One difference I do see is no msix_vector values:

                                  dev.igc.3.iflib.allocated_msix_vectors: 2
                                  dev.igc.3.iflib.use_extra_msix_vectors: 0
                                  

                                  Do you see that in the boot logs?

                                  igc0: <Intel(R) Ethernet Controller I226-V> mem 0x67a00000-0x67afffff,0x67b00000-0x67b03fff at device 0.0 on pci2
                                  igc0: Using 1024 TX descriptors and 1024 RX descriptors
                                  igc0: Using 1 RX queues 1 TX queues
                                  igc0: Using MSI-X interrupts with 2 vectors
                                  igc0: Ethernet address: 00:08:a2:12:ec:d4
                                  igc0: netmap queues/slots: TX 1/1024, RX 1/1024

                                    Oh and note that the igc driver can only link using negotiated speed and duplex. It will fail to connect to a NIC that is actually using a fixed speed and does not negotiate.
